BRIGG DEAL A ‘SAVIOUR’

BRIGG Town’s future has been assured after they were bought out by a local company.
Founded in 1864 and one of the world’s oldest football clubs, the two-time FA Vase winners have been hit by financial problems in recent times.
Once members of the Northern Premier Division One South, the Zebras are now struggling at Step 6 in Division One of the Toolstation North West Counties East League.
Their Hawthorns ground has been bought by local company EC Surfacing Limited, who have leased them back to the Zebras at advantageous terms.
